Gene expression signatures for miR-26a over-expression and negative control in hela cells. Homo sapiens

To further development of our gene expression approach to microRNA-26a over-expression, we have employed whole mRNA microarray expression profiling as a discovery platform. Hela cells at 70–80% confluence in 6-well plates were transfected using Lipofectamine 2000 (Invitrogen). Negative control mimics or miR-26a mimics (100nM) were transfected in each well. Cell extracts were prepared 48 h after transfection, total RNA was checked for a RIN number to inspect RNA integration by an Agilent Bioanalyzer 2100 (Agilent technologies, Santa Clara, CA, US). Overall design: Hela cells at 70–80% confluence in 6-well plates were transfected using Lipofectamine 2000 (Invitrogen). Negative control mimics or miR-26a mimics (100nM) were transfected in each well. Total RNA was prepared 48 h after transfection.
